Definition
Noun: A quilting bee is a social gathering, traditionally of women, where people come together to work on making a quilt or multiple quilts. The primary purpose is collaborative sewing, but it also serves as an important community and social event.
Usage
The term is used to describe a specific type of community work party focused on the craft of quilting. It emphasizes cooperation, shared labor, and social interaction.

Variants and Related Words
- Bee: (noun) An old-fashioned term for a gathering where people combine work and socializing, e.g., , .
- Quilting: (noun) The craft or process of making a quilt.
- Sewing circle: (noun) A similar social gathering for sewing, though not necessarily focused on quilts.
